yemblaze:
I paid 10k then oo but now its 27k for secondary verification for WES.

PROCESS: There is a LASU UBA account called LASU Revenue Account at LASU. After payment, take the teller to the LASU bursary office (Admin block 2) where the teller would be converted to a receipt. Write your WES REF NO ontop of the receipt. Take it to the Exams and Records department located at ICT and ask for the Transcript verification officer. Drop a copy of your receipt with your WES reference number, name and matric number BOLDLY written on it.

Re: Canadian Express Entry/federal Skilled Workers Program - Connect Here Part 7 by Topsmamen: 9:46am On Apr 23, 2019
abyejecks:
Pls for my work experience, I was paid cash. I want to submit pay slips and write paid in cash on the reference letter to avoid adr for bank statement as I wasn't paid via bank. Asides pay slips, is there any other payment evidence. Hope it won't affect my application. I no longer work there.

Thanks

It won't affect your application. Just state in your reference letter that you were paid in cash.

Your reference letter is the most important. Payslips, employment letters, bank statements from places of employment are optional. Don't worry over your inability to provide documents that are not requested by CIC.

Ok let me try to do a better job. We started this process In February of 2017. We requested WES evaluation after obtaining our transcripts. Wify was the primary applicant. During our time, we didn’t have to do evaluation for WAEC. I think the WES report came around May or June. We wrote IELTS in April and passed at the first attempt. Then we calculated our score, it was around 407. Hmmm, we knew we had to add something to get a higher score. Fortunately for us, wify was in her final year with university of Roehampton online MBA program. So we waited till July of 2018 when she completed the program , then we added her masters and scored 443. That was in August 2018. We entered the pool and by September we got ITA. For the medical, I walked into IOM at ikeja GRA and got an appointment for October 24th I think. We submitted our application on November 2nd, did biometrics in the first week of December and then got PPR April 2019. I think this is better �
